Setting Up VoIP: A Beginner's Guide to Voice Over IP
Embarking on the adventure of setting up Voice Over IP (VoIP) can seem complex at first, but it's actually surprisingly straightforward. VoIP, or internet telephony, allows you to make and receive phone calls using your existing internet connection. Here's a basic overview to get you started. First, you'll need to select a VoIP provider; research different options, considering factors like costs, features, and assistance. Next, install your VoIP software or hardware. Many providers offer dedicated apps for computers and mobile devices. Alternatively, you might use a VoIP phone system or an analog telephone adapter (ATA) to connect a traditional phone.

Internet Calling Configuration Best Practices: Optimizing Performance and Stability
A robust VoIP setup copyrights on meticulous planning and consistent maintenance. For achieving high operation, implement these key techniques. To begin with, verify your data link speed and latency. Low bandwidth or high latency can lead to poor audio quality. Moreover, properly configure your Quality of Service (QoS) on your network devices to prioritize VoIP data packets. Additionally, utilize secure infrastructure, including devices and routers, from reputable vendors. In conclusion, regularly monitor call quality and connection integrity using diagnostic software.
